6.2 Heat Exchanger Heat exchangers are inherently stable operating units. Extensive instrumentation is therefore not usually proposed. However: control on flow parameters is necessary and proper indication and recording of the inlet and outlet conditions is recommended. Temperature measuring elements and heat-exchanger installation should be placed as close as possible to the active heat exchange surface, consistent with requirements for adequate mixing of the process stream. A thermal element installed several feet downstream of the exchanger in the process .pipeline will cause a time delay in the control system. This time delay or distance-velocity lag has a particularly noticeable effect on control performance. Thermocouples in protective thermal well are proposed' as temperature measuring elements.
